/*
* Imports.
*/
import { RecipeInterface } from "supertokens-web-js/recipe/multifactorauth";
import { getNormalisedUserContext } from "../../utils";
import { RecipeComponentsOverrideContextProvider } from "./componentOverrideContext";
import MultiFactorAuthRecipe from "./recipe";
import { GetRedirectionURLContext, PreAPIHookContext, OnHandleEventContext } from "./types";
import { UserInput, FactorIds } from "./types";
import type { Navigate, UserContext } from "../../types";
import type { RecipeFunctionOptions } from "supertokens-web-js/recipe/multifactorauth";
import type { MFAFactorInfo } from "supertokens-web-js/recipe/multifactorauth/types";
export default class Wrapper {
static MultiFactorAuthClaim = MultiFactorAuthRecipe.MultiFactorAuthClaim;
static FactorIds = FactorIds;
static init(config?: UserInput) {
return MultiFactorAuthRecipe.init(config);
}
static resyncSessionAndFetchMFAInfo(input?: {
userContext?: UserContext;
options?: RecipeFunctionOptions;
}): Promise<{
status: "OK";
factors: MFAFactorInfo;
emails: Record<string, string[] | undefined>;
phoneNumbers: Record<string, string[] | undefined>;
fetchResponse: Response;
}> {
return MultiFactorAuthRecipe.getInstanceOrThrow().webJSRecipe.resyncSessionAndFetchMFAInfo({
...input,
userContext: getNormalisedUserContext(input?.userContext),
});
}
static redirectToFactor(
factorId: string,
forceSetup = false,
redirectBack = true,
navigate?: Navigate,
userContext?: UserContext
) {
return MultiFactorAuthRecipe.getInstanceOrThrow().redirectToFactor(
factorId,
forceSetup,
redirectBack,
navigate,
userContext
);
}
static redirectToFactorChooser(
redirectBack = true,
nextFactorOptions: string[] = [],
navigate?: Navigate,
userContext?: UserContext
) {
return MultiFactorAuthRecipe.getInstanceOrThrow().redirectToFactorChooser(
redirectBack,
nextFactorOptions,
navigate,
userContext
);
}
static ComponentsOverrideProvider = RecipeComponentsOverrideContextProvider;
}
const init = Wrapper.init;
const resyncSessionAndFetchMFAInfo = Wrapper.resyncSessionAndFetchMFAInfo;
const redirectToFactor = Wrapper.redirectToFactor;
const redirectToFactorChooser = Wrapper.redirectToFactorChooser;
const MultiFactorAuthComponentsOverrideProvider = Wrapper.ComponentsOverrideProvider;
const MultiFactorAuthClaim = MultiFactorAuthRecipe.MultiFactorAuthClaim;
export {
init,
resyncSessionAndFetchMFAInfo,
redirectToFactor,
redirectToFactorChooser,
MultiFactorAuthComponentsOverrideProvider,
GetRedirectionURLContext,
PreAPIHookContext as PreAPIHookContext,
OnHandleEventContext,
UserInput,
RecipeInterface,
MultiFactorAuthClaim,
FactorIds,
};
